On behalf of the Zoltán Kodály Musical Pedagogy Institute of the Liszt Academy, I would like to invite everyone to a short introductory course.
You might be curious to know how the 150-year-old Liszt Academy, founded by Ferenc Liszt, comes to have so many talented and well-trained young Hungarian musicians? What is the secret behind the success of Hungarian music education, which has made us world-famous and inspired you to choose this university? Besides Ferenc Liszt, there is another name—that of the renowned composer Zoltán Kodály—who, through his efforts and work, and by consistently implementing the pedagogical concept known by his name, laid the foundation for Hungarian music education and the success of Hungarian musicians around the world.
At the Kodály Institute of the Liszt Academy, we have developed an English-language e-learning course that we would like to present to international students to introduce them to Zoltán Kodály's life's work and his music education concept.
